A high school in Brockville, Ontario, was placed under lockdown on Tuesday after authorities received a bomb and weapons threat. The Brockville Police Service responded to the incident, securing the school and ensuring the safety of students and staff.
Police Response
Officers were dispatched to the school following the threat, and the building was immediately placed on lockdown. Police conducted a thorough search of the premises but have not released details about any suspicious items found. The lockdown was lifted after several hours, and students were allowed to return home.
Investigation Ongoing
The Brockville Police Service is continuing its investigation into the source of the threat. No arrests have been reported at this time. Authorities are urging anyone with information to come forward.
This incident comes amid a series of security concerns at schools across the region. Police have not indicated any connection to other threats.
